AUBRURNDALE, FL -The SUNY Brockport Golden Eagles (6-2) defeated the Wisconsin-Superior YellowJackets in each of the seven inning doubleheader games on Wednesday afternoon. The Golden Eagles were victorious in game one by a score of 21-2 and won game two 7-0 outscoring Wisconsin-Superior 28-2 between both games.

Game 1 Recap
Â
Batting Summery
12 different Golden Eagles recorded hits in game one with five different batters recording extra base hits including
Zach Eldred who hit his first career home run.
Frank Vanzillotta,
Ryan Voight, and
Zach Eldred each had Multiple hits in game while Voight, Eldred,
Tom Kretzler and
Jason Mansell each recorded multi base hits. Eldred's extra base hit came from a two run home run, the first of his collegiate career.

Pitching Summery
Four different Golden Eagles saw innings on the mound as
Cooper Meldrim got the start going three scoreless innings allowing two hits and punching out eight batters. With
Ryan Peters (1-0) earning the win, he went one inning giving up one hit and striking out three batters. Matt Denatale,
Michael Heilig and
Ryley O'Connell each managed to get an inning on the bump as well. Between the four different pitches they combined for 16 total punchouts in the game.

Game 2 Recap
Â
Batting Summery
Tom Kretzler went 2-2 in game two scoring two runs and two RBIs in the teams 7-0 shutout victory to earn the double header sweep.
Jake Sisto went 2-3 with one run while
Matt O'Dair,
Ryan Voight,
Ryan Mansell, and
Ryan Mroczka each recorded. Mansell's hit came from a moonshot homerun.

Pitching Summery
Jake Jempty (1-0) earned his first win of the season as the junior transfer from Cortlandt Manor went five scoreless innings throwing three strikeouts while only giving up four hits through 19 batters.
Keegan Jarvais and
Zach Eldred each threw one inning in the game. Jarvais recorded three outs on four batters on one walk while Eldred struck out the side to close the game out.
